EC Tree |
1. Oxidoreductases |
1.14 Acting on paired donors, with incorporation or reduction of molecular oxygen |
1.14.11 With 2-oxoglutarate as one donor, and incorporation of one atom of oxygen into each donor |
ID: | 1.14.11.32 |
---|---|
Description: | Codeine 3-O-demethylase. |
Alternative Name: |
Codeine O-demethylase. |

RHEA:27413 | 2-oxoglutarate + codeine + O2 = CO2 + formaldehyde + morphine + succinate |
